Naija
Etymology
From: English wash-and-wear
Pronunciation
- wɒ́ʃ-æ̀n-wɛə̂
Noun
Name of cloth wey no dey need iroing.
- Dis one wey light no dey to iron so, na wash and wear remain. — (NSC_Olukayode.S.M_2020, There is no power to iron, the only option left, is to wash-and-wear.)
Related forms
Translation
- English: wash-and-wear
Adjective
- Sey person get only one cloth.
- Dat guy na wash and wear im dey do eveytime. — ( NSC_Olukayode.S.M_2020, That guy is always putting on the same set of clothing every time.
- Dat wash and wear guy don come visit dat babe again o. — (NSC_Shulammite_2020, That guy that washes and wear his cloth is here to see that girl again.)
